Description:
Explore the world of cross-platform native module development in this 51-minute podcast episode featuring Jamie Birch, creator of React NativeScript. Delve into the challenges of using native modules across different ecosystems and discover how Open Native aims to address these issues. Learn about the inception of Open Native, its functionalities, and its potential impact on developers working across platforms. Gain insights into the practical steps taken within the React Native ecosystem and NativeScript community towards implementing Open Native. Understand the current landscape of cross-platform development, the role of Expo Unimodules, and the specific architectural decisions in React Native. Examine the runtime aspects and compare Open Native with React Native implementation.
